The Birth of a Galaxy: The Original Trilogy

The journey began not with a whisper, but with a cultural explosion that no one saw coming. The initial release of Star Wars in 1977, later subtitled Episode IV: A New Hope, rewrote the rules of blockbuster filmmaking. This was followed by The Empire Strikes Back in 1980, which deepened the narrative and shocked audiences with its darker tone. The saga concluded the original run with Return of the Jedi in 1983, delivering a satisfying end to the Skywalker saga that solidified the films as timeless classics.

The Prequel Era Expands the Universe

After a long hiatus, the franchise returned to the screen with a new set of stories set decades before the originals. The release of Episode I: The Phantom Menace in 1999 introduced a younger Anakin Skywalker and expanded the political landscape of the Republic. This was followed by Episode II: Attack of the Clones in 2002 and Episode III: Revenge of the Sith in 2005, exploring the fall of the Jedi and the rise of the Empire, completing the chronological story of Anakin’s tragedy.

The Sequel Trilogy and Modern Era

The saga continued with a new generation of heroes, beginning with The Force Awakens in 2015. This film bridged the gap between the old and new, earning massive box office success and rekindling global interest. The journey progressed with The Last Jedi in 2017 and The Rise of Skywalker in 2019, offering a definitive conclusion to the main Skywalker lineage while introducing fresh characters and interstellar conflicts.

Spin-Offs and the Multiverse of Stories

Beyond the core saga, the galaxy has expanded through numerous stand-alone films that explore different corners of the Star Wars universe. Rogue One: A Star Wars Story arrived in 2016, offering a gritty, war-focused narrative that directly connects to the events of the original trilogy. Solo: A Star Wars Story in 2018 delved into the origins of Han Solo, while the animated realm continued to thrive with films like Star Wars: The Clone Wars, cementing the franchise’s presence across multiple mediums.
